Output 103334e189aac10fd3fa63c712d8de9c052493375cce9e8a771a2d69833ff39c:0

value
3245776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 843ebb1a7ad393756c52e02bf4996b86460f9fea OP_EQUAL
address
3DkGGUxUDm3P7GfcMjLZCZnP3JoKEF3wNp
transaction
103334e189aac10fd3fa63c712d8de9c052493375cce9e8a771a2d69833ff39c
spent
true